I may be going rules blind at this stage.......

Multiple Short:  The rules says this applies to firearms and certain spells.  But the only spell I can see that this applies to is Fireball but it then says when boosting you shoot 1 bigger fireball or several smaller ones, but they both act have the same result and add damage.

Am I missing a spell - or should this really only apply to firearms? 


Addendum:

Again I'm thinking about how to code this - so I'm getting to having two weapons options - automatic and semi-automatic.  Either can use the multiple shot rules but only automatics can use the automatic fire advanced rules.  This way the GM can create the weapons they want (can perhaps say a revolver is not semi-auto, but a .45 auto would be and a machine pistol is fully automatic).



Any thoughts?
